Five Eyes Agencies Sound Alarm About AI’s Growing Threat to Cybersecurity

Ai-Powered Cyber Attacks Targeting Critical Infrastructure

The Five Eyes intelligence alliance, comprising the United States, United Kingdom, Canada, Australia, and New Zealand, has issued a stark warning about the growing threat that artificial intelligence (AI) poses to global cybersecurity. According to a joint report released today, advanced AI systems developed by nation-state actors and cybercriminals are rapidly outpacing the defensive capabilities of many organizations and governments.

AI-Powered Cyber Attacks on the Rise

The report highlights how adversaries are increasingly using AI to automate and scale up their cyber attack capabilities. AI-powered tools are being used to rapidly identify and exploit vulnerabilities, execute complex hacking campaigns, and evade detection by traditional security measures. The Five Eyes agencies warn that these AI-driven attacks are becoming more sophisticated, targeted, and difficult to defend against.

Challenges in Securing AI Systems

One of the key challenges identified in the report is the inherent vulnerability of AI systems themselves. The agencies note that many AI models and algorithms can be manipulated or “poisoned” to turn them against their intended purposes. Adversaries are finding ways to inject malicious data into AI training sets or hijack the decision-making processes of AI-powered systems, transforming them into effective offensive weapons.

Urgent Need for AI Security Innovations

The Five Eyes report calls for immediate action to address these emerging AI-driven cyber threats. It emphasizes the critical need for significant investments in AI security research and the development of novel defensive AI technologies. The agencies also stress the importance of international cooperation and information-sharing to stay ahead of the rapidly evolving AI-powered cyber threat landscape.

Protecting Critical Infrastructure and Data

The report warns that the impact of successful AI-powered cyber attacks could be devastating, with the potential to disrupt critical infrastructure, compromise sensitive data, and even threaten national security. The Five Eyes agencies urge governments, businesses, and organizations worldwide to prioritize the security of their AI systems and to work collaboratively to mitigate the growing risks.

Frequently Asked Questions

How do the Five Eyes agencies detect AI threats to cybersecurity?

The Five Eyes agencies use advanced AI monitoring and analysis tools to detect emerging threats to cybersecurity. They closely track the development of AI-powered malware, hacking techniques, and other AI-driven attacks to stay ahead of the curve.

What is the growing threat of AI to cybersecurity according to the Five Eyes?

According to the Five Eyes agencies, the growing threat of AI to cybersecurity includes the use of AI-powered malware, automated hacking tools, and AI-driven social engineering attacks. AI is making it easier for cybercriminals to scale their operations and evade detection.

Why are the Five Eyes agencies concerned about the threat of AI to cybersecurity?

The Five Eyes agencies are concerned about the threat of AI to cybersecurity because AI can be used to automate and scale up cyber attacks, making them more efficient and difficult to detect. AI-powered tools can also be used to generate more convincing phishing emails and social engineering attacks.

Which cybersecurity best practices can organizations use to mitigate the threat of AI-powered attacks?

Cybersecurity best practices to mitigate the threat of AI-powered attacks include implementing strong access controls, regularly updating software and systems, providing employee training on spotting social engineering attempts, and investing in AI-powered security tools to detect and respond to AI-driven threats.
